Increasing temperature makes the … WebConclusion Temperature Below 0 °C - Ice crystals form in the membrane, piercing it and allowing molecules including beetroot pigment to leak out. 0°C - 40°C - As temperature increases the phospholipids in the membrane gain kinetic energy and move more , increasing the permeability. Over 40°C - Proteins in the membrane deform at high …
